Can't see subscribed users

Problem: Subscribed users are not appearing in the Amazon Q Developer console.

You have subscribed one or more users to the Pro tier, but when you navigate to the Amazon Q Developer console's Subscriptions page, you can't see them.

Solutions:

  • Make sure you're signed in to the correct AWS account and AWS Region.

  • Try switching to the Amazon Q console. The Amazon Q console is able to display users who were subscribed as part of a group, and is also able to display subscriptions across multiple accounts in an organization managed by AWS Organizations.

  • If you switched to the Amazon Q console, and still can't see users, do the following:

    • Make sure you're in the correct AWS Region. You will need to be in the Region where your IAM Identity Center instance is deployed. This might be a different Region from your Amazon Q Developer console and profile.

    • If you're using AWS Organizations, try enabling trusted access so that you can see subscriptions in both management and member accounts. For more information, see Viewing an aggregated list of Amazon Q Developer subscriptions.
